The Role
We’re looking for an energetic, self-driven Collections Specialist to resolve delinquent mortgage accounts and support homeowners through the collections process. You will manage early-stage arrears (1–30 days), negotiate repayment solutions, and help homeowners stay on track.
Key responsibilities include:
- Resolve delinquent accounts (1–30 days) through collections and/or alternate arrangements
- Work proactively with homeowners to prevent future arrears
- Address homeowner inquiries related to:
- Lapsed home insurance
- Condominium and tax arrears
- Shortfalls at payout
- Handle inbound calls and emails to resolve mortgage arrears; occasionally initiate outbound calls on a case-by-case basis
- Evaluate each account by reviewing loan particulars and payment history to determine the appropriate course of action for both MCAP-owned and sub-serviced mortgages
- Negotiate appropriate repayment remedies on a case-by-case basis
- Maintain accurate and organized account records by updating memos, confirming arrangements with homeowners (written and verbal), posting payments, and documenting all workout arrangements to ensure arrears are collected in a timely manner
